Crime rate in Grosse Ile, MI

The 2022 crime rate in Grosse Ile, MI is 18 (City-Data.com crime index), which is 13.5 times smaller than the U.S. average. It was higher than in 13.2% U.S. cities. The 2022 Grosse Ile crime rate rose by 103% compared to 2021. In the last 5 years Grosse Ile has seen decreasing violent crime and decreasing property crime.

The City-Data.com crime index weighs serious crimes and violent crimes more heavily. Higher means more crime, U.S. average is 246.1. It adjusts for the number of visitors and daily workers commuting into cities.




According to our research of Michigan and other state lists, there were 6 registered sex offenders living in Grosse Ile, Michigan as of May 15, 2024.
The ratio of all residents to sex offenders in Grosse Ile is 1,747 to 1.
The ratio of registered sex offenders to all residents in this city is much lower than the state average.
